White underwent Tommy John surgery immediately after participating in 2022 spring training, forcing him to miss the entirety of the season.[12] On November 15, 2022, the Rays selected his contract and added him to the 40-man roster.[13] White was optioned to Durham to begin the 2023 season and also played for the Rookie-levelFlorida Complex League Rays and Bowling Green.[14] Over 22 innings pitched for the season, he went 1–0 with a 1.64 ERA and 24 strikeouts.[15]
White was optioned to Triple–A Durham to begin the 2024 season.[16] In 9 games for the Bulls, he struggled to a 17.61 ERA with 10 strikeouts across 7+2⁄3 innings. On May 3, 2024, White was designated for assignment by the Rays.[17]
New York Yankees
On May 9, 2024, White was claimed off waivers by the New York Yankees.[18] He struggled to a 27.00 ERA in two games for the Double–A Somerset Patriots before he was designated for assignment on May 20.[19] White cleared waivers and was outrighted to Somerset on May 23.[20] In 29 total appearances for Somerset, he posted a 2-0 record and 3.34 ERA with 40 strikeouts across 32+1⁄3 innings pitched.
White made four appearances for Somerset in 2025, but struggled to a 12.79 ERA with five strikeouts in 6+1⁄3 innings pitched. White was released by the Yankees organization on April 25, 2025.[21]
